While skin tests are useful for identifying potentially problematic allergens, it is almost impossible to use test results to predict the probable severity of an allergic reaction to those substances. For instance, the test may show that you are sensitive to one type of spore. It may be that you suffer only very mild symptoms when the allergen is present, or you may suffer nothing whatsoever.

It’s very common for people to recommend humidifiers to allergy sufferers, as it can help moisten airways as people sleep. This procedure is not without potential drawbacks. Increasing the room’s humidity can encourage mustiness and the mold growth in fertile areas like the carpeting. Try using saline spray prior to bed for keeping your nasal passages moist.

Keep windows shut when pollen is most likely to be floating around. While it is good to get fresh air inside your home, you want to avoid opening windows when the pollen is the highest outside. Watch your local news program to see when pollen is highest in your area, or visit the weather section of local news websites to learn about times and levels. If you want to air out your house, wait until this block of time has passed.

When sleeping, instead of using a pillows made of natural materials or feathers, you should use a synthetic pillow. Dust mites prefer natural materials, and will avoid synthetic material. Even though you should wash them to get rid of allergens, they are better for sleeping on.

Avoid opening windows during high pollen hours. Fresh air is great for your home, but when the pollen count is high, don’t open windows. From around 10 in the morning until 3 in the afternoon, pollen is at its peak. Air your home out before or after these hours.

Your child may need medication administered at school if they suffer from allergies. When your child is going to school, however, you might encounter some issues with having these medications around other children. Be sure the school knows about the condition and the medicine. Provide your child’s school nurse with these instructions and one or two emergency doses of medication. You should also give his school a document that lists all allergies and put one in your child’s backpack, too.
